WebJan 3, 2024 · The familiar religions were a little bit wrong; religions from far-flung parts of the world were very wrong. Indigenous religions were savagery. And mystical experiences were the province of the crazy. Into this world came Huston Smith’s 1958 book, The Religions of Man. With a spirit of open inquiry and enthusiasm about all the world’s ...
